Machine learning for prediction of in-hospital mortality in lung cancer patients admitted to intensive care unit
<h4>Backgrounds</h4> The in-hospital mortality in lung cancer patients admitted to intensive care unit (ICU) is extremely high. This study intended to adopt machine learning algorithm models to predict in-hospital mortality of critically ill lung cancer for providing relative information...
